Sleep Better & Live Well with Help from Tunable Lighting  

Do you wake up feeling groggy each morning, hitting the snooze button until you’re running late? Do you rely on several cups of coffee to get through the day? And by nightfall, do you lie in bed with racing thoughts, unable to sleep? 

If that sounds like your daily experience, your circadian rhythm may be out of sync. The circadian rhythm is the internal clock that tells our bodies when to feel alert, sleepy, and even hungry. Our circadian rhythms are self-regulated but are largely influenced by the sun. 

So, what happens to our inner clock if we spend most of our time indoors? Artificial lighting can throw our sleep patterns off course, wreaking havoc on our health. Luckily, smart lighting control systems are transforming how we light our homes, leading to healthier lifestyles.

Why DIY Smart Lighting Doesn’t Measure Up to Professional Control Systems  

Once you’ve experienced smart lighting at home, it’s hard to go back to the standard on/off light switch. With smart lighting, you can bathe rooms in any color and brightness imaginable, from the coziest candlelight hue to fun nightlife colors. 

Many homeowners are tempted to DIY smart lighting with Bluetooth or Wi-Fi-connected smart bulbs from Amazon or Best Buy. But they may be unaware that for seamless control and automation—even from miles away—you need a sophisticated smart system like Lutron or Control4

What’s the difference between a dedicated lighting system and DIY smart lights? We’ll compare both below, so you know what to expect for your lighting control
